Black Ceremony, A Daytime Fireworks Show in Qatar by Cai Guo-Qiang

Chinese artist Cai Guo-Qiang with the pyrotechnic Grucci family, put on quite the daytime fireworks show for the opening of Cai Guo-Qiang: Saraab at Mathaf, Arab Museum of Modern Art in Qatar. The December 5, 2011 event was called Black Ceremony which was “a progression of ten different scenes exploring themes of death and homecoming”.

The explosion event appeared like drops of ink splattered across the sky, instantaneously creating black blossoms, followed by thunderous noise. 8,300 shells embedded with computer microchips were ignited to form a black pyramid that stands above the earth, as if a wordless tombstone. Black Ceremony took place near the museum and was open to the public.
